Perfection of life consists in drawing close to God. Heaven is the possession of God. In heaven, God is contemplated, adored, loved.
But to attain heaven it’s necessary to be detached from what is earthly.
What is the life of a Carmelite if not one of contemplating, adoring, and loving God incessantly? And she, by being desirous for that heaven, distances herself from the world and tries to detach herself as much as possible from everything earthly.
Saint Teresa of the Andes
Her intimate spiritual diary
Resolutions, Autumn 1919 (excerpt)
